We believe in the power of the CMB community coming together under one roof to be educated, connected and challenged. Momentum 2023 guarantees to provide just that! CMB’s premiere event takes place May 31 - June 2 in Orlando, designed specifically for those in Christian radio. Momentum is packed full of speakers, performances, breakouts, workshops, networking and so much more. You will leave inspired, encouraged and ready to impact your community through Christian music.

Workshops
Momentum Workshops, taking place Wednesday morning (May 31), are designed to offer 2 hours of strategic and compelling education to advance your professional development in your role at your station. REGISTRATION
What’s included in my Momentum 2023 registration?
Full registration includes lunch, dinner and snacks Wednesday, May 31 – Friday, June 2 (breakfast not included) as well as all educational sessions, music performances and a ticket to one of the Universal Studios parks (must attend Momentum Worship on 5/31 to receive your ticket).
Does CMB offer any discounts?
CMB Gold Members attend for free! There are also discounts for CMB Silver Members, Spouse/Child 10+, College Professors, Students and International attendees. Scholarships are available for those who need financial assistance. Learn more about scholarships >>
Can I get a refund or exchange?
All refund requests received in writing by May 19 will be honored. A $50 cancellation fee will apply to each registration refunded. The total refund applied will be LESS credit card/service fees and a $50 cancellation fee. After May 19, NO REFUNDS AVAILABLE.
Does my spouse or child need a ticket? Can they eat with me at meals if they aren’t registered?
CMB offers a special registration rate for spouses and children. If you would like to purchase a meal ticket for any additional guests, the cost is $60 for lunch and $80 for dinner. Meal tickets must be purchased in advance and are not available for purchase during Momentum. To purchase, contact info@cmbonline.org.
Is a Universal park ticket included in my Momentum registration?
Yes! Everyone with a full registration will receive a ticket to one of the Universal Studios parks to be used on Wednesday night (must attend Momentum Worship to receive your ticket).
Will we receive an Express Pass with the ticket to a Universal Orlando™ theme park?
Unfortunately, Express Passes are not included. They are available for an additional fee. You may purchase an Express Pass HERE.
Is there an On Demand option?
Yes! You can purchase Momentum On Demand, which includes videos from the main stage speakers and audio from all of the breakout sessions for both Thursday and Friday. Please note that this does not include workshops or performances and is not live. We believe that attending in person is the BEST way to experience Momentum and get the full experience of all that’s offered. The On Demand link will be emailed to you the week of June 5 and will expire on September 1.

What are Momentum Workshops?
The Momentum Workshops will take place Wednesday morning, May 31. These workshops will be two-hours of topic related concepts with interactive learning and discussions. There are six different workshops topics (Leadership, Music/Programming, On-Air, Promotions, Revenue & Social/Digital Media) to choose from where you can learn more and develop new skills in that area of concentration.
